Description: Fluke PowerLog allows a user to download recorded data from the Fluke power quality meters to a user workstation. The technology also provides users with the ability to generate data tables, view and print time plots of all channels, perform harmonic studies, and export data to other programs. PowerLog has been split into two editions, PowerLog Classic and PowerLog 430-II. Both editions are covered in this assessment.

Note: Please refer to the release notes to identify which edition and version of the software is compatible with each Fluke Device Model Number.

Note: This evaluation covers only the software associated with the hardware, and not the hardware itself.
